I invited a 3rd party vendor to our instance and they are not able to access any project after logging in.
When I go to Administration and check the user's account I am seeing they have not logged in.
The vendor has its own Jira cloud instance and is using Gmail to login. When they click the invite email it automatically redirects them to login with their Gmail information.
Is this why I am seeing the user as "Never seen on this site"? Is there a way to bypass this?
Yes, if they also have a cloud instance and used that specific browser to log in to their instance then this is expected. I would ask the user to either use a different browser or use a incognito window to log on to your instance.
that was the first thing i asked, they did and it still re-directed them to enter their gmail credentials.
FYI - They are logging in using the invite link they received in their email.
